A stdio MCP server's lifeline is stdin: when the host/client goes away, stdin should end and the server should exit. The server paths listened for stdin 'end'/'close' but NOT 'error'. That gap bites with a socket-backed stdin — the shape VS Code / Claude Code use (a socketpair, not a pipe). On client death the socket can surface as an 'error' (ECONNRESET/hangup) instead of a clean 'close'. Unhandled, it escalated to the process-wide uncaughtException handler, which logs and keeps running — so the server orphaned instead of exiting. On Linux a POLLHUP socket fd left registered in epoll then wakes the event loop continuously, pinning a core at 100% CPU; once the main thread spins, the setInterval PPID watchdog can't even fire, so the orphan runs forever (the report's 28+ minutes). Add treatStdinFailureAsShutdown(): listen for 'error' as well as 'end'/'close', and DESTROY the stdin stream on any terminal event so the fd leaves epoll and can't churn, then run the path's shutdown. Wired into the live paths — startDirect, the local-handshake proxy, and StdioTransport — plus the legacy pipe proxy. Fires once (re-entry guard). Note: this is hardening for a class of failure that matches every piece of the report's evidence (socket stdin, userspace main-thread spin, high involuntary context switches, watchdog never firing), but the exact 100% CPU spin could not be reproduced in Docker (Linux) across /dev/null EOF, socket peer-death (RST/FIN), the reporter's 0.9.7 bundle, and the npx chain — all exited cleanly — so the trigger is environment-specific.
